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05 13295998 6212986842 010780491
597860 27224441
597860 27224441
72518 9699 91644
All about undefined
Interested in learning more?
597860 27224441
72518 9699 91644
See more
91 959 3944955251
42174654 105952 60280775319 97295791
See more
1033026342 467858879 7252338
91 3813465 6588673
See more